Stacey Solomon appealed for help to achieve a 'newborn fresh' look after welcoming her fifth child earlier this month. The Loose Women panellist and Sort Your Life Out presenter announced on February 11 that she had given birth to her second daughter Belle with former EastEnders sar Joe Swash.
Last week she typed in a heartfelt post to their newborn: "Oh Hello Beautiful Belle. The most special two weeks of you Belle… Today all the boys went back to school & Belle had lots of awake time.
"I think she was wondering where all the noise and craziness had gone i felt like I got some time to properly see her & talk to her today. I love these days when they start to open their eyes more & really look around and begin to show you little bits of who they are and the adventures to come."

This afternoon (Sunday February 26) the 33-year-old, who has been sharing her parenting journey with her 5.6M Instagram followers, took to her page to ask for answers as she tried out a new look. "I just need to know the answer to this because it's bugging me," she said. "I've scraped my hair back into a bun today becausie I keep seeing people do it."
Stacey, with an arm and hand concealing her head, said: "I've seen Molly-Mae do it and she looks so beautiful. I call it newborn fresh." She explained: "Like, you've got a newborn so you just scrape your hair back and chuck it in a bun and you just look really pretty and natural and it pulls all your face back. Beautiful."
Stacey then whipped her arm away to reveal her hair was scraped back into a bun on top of her head. "Why when I do it do I look like Miss Trunchbull?" she asked comically. "Why?"
